Costner Elementary is a public elementary school located in Dallas, North Carolina, serving grades PK-5 with a total enrollment of 453 students. The school is part of the Gaston County Schools district, which is ranked 149 out of 242 school districts in North Carolina and is rated 2 stars out of 5 by SchoolDigger.
Costner Elementary has consistently performed below the Gaston County Schools and North Carolina state averages in most subject areas and grade levels over the past few years. For example, in 2024-2025, Costner Elementary's proficiency rates in Mathematics were 43.4% for 3rd grade, 62.2% for 4th grade, and 56.5% for 5th grade, compared to the Gaston County Schools averages of 57.4%, 51.3%, and 49.3%, respectively. Similarly, in Reading, Costner Elementary's proficiency rates were 38.6% for 3rd grade, 54.1% for 4th grade, and 49.3% for 5th grade, compared to the Gaston County Schools averages of 37.3%, 50.9%, and 44.3%, respectively.
The high percentage of students receiving free or reduced-price lunch at Costner Elementary (over 99%) is a significant factor that likely contributes to the school's academic challenges. However, the school's higher-than-average spending per student could indicate that additional resources are available to support student learning, which could be further explored. Additionally, Carr Elementary and Tryon Elementary, nearby schools in the Gaston County Schools district, have higher proficiency rates in Mathematics, Reading, and Science, suggesting potential opportunities for improvement at Costner Elementary.
